herring-bone

noun

Meaning

  1. A bone of a herring
  2. A zigzag pattern, especially made by bricks, on a cloth, or by stitches in sewing
  3. A method of climbing a hill by pointing the skis outward in a V-shape to keep from sliding backwards.
  4. Twilled fabric woven in rows of parallel sloping lines
